Hi Folks, Welcome to the new Facebook page for the Kingston Scout Museum! We have thousands of artifacts, pictures and newspaper articles - mostly about scouting in this area. It is our hope that by posting some of the pictures and articles here that you might relive some memories, or, be able to help us expand on the story. Canadian Scouts ... World Jamboree ... Canadian Aircraft Carrier ... all in one slideshow! These are the pictures and memories of a former scout from Dartmouth..., N.S., now living in Bath, as narrated by Bill Lewis, one of our Directors.
